Why can’t the governor be honest with his proposal to raise the B&O tax? His proposal is to “increase the business and occupation tax on services provided by accountants, attorneys, real estate agents and others from 1.5 percent to 2.5 percent. What he does not say is that service providers includes the person that cuts your hair, the guy that mows your lawn, or fixes your lawnmower.
The governor also fails to mention that many of the businesses that are going to be hurt the worst, are same businesses that are going to be affected the most by the new minimum wage law.
